The Sword is a melee weapon available to the Light Build.

Overview

Attacking with primary fire will quickly slash the Sword, dealing a moderate amount of damage. Holding secondary fire and releasing will perform a high-damage stab, where the user will lunge forward a short distance and deal heavy damage to its target.

As opposed to the Dagger, the Sword does not deal bonus damage from behind.

Since the Sword belongs to the Light Build, it generally fulfills a "Hit and Run", "glass cannon" playstyle.

Useful damage combinations include:

  • 1 Alt Fire → Quick Melee = 188 Damage
  • 1 Alt Fire → 1 Primary Fire → Quick Melee = 254 Damage
  • 2 Alt Fire → 1 Primary Fire = 354 Damage

Pros and Cons

The Sword has high damage potential, and is used as an aggressive melee-range weapon. It has a slightly longer range than the Dagger.

Like many other melee weapons, the Sword leaves the wielder vulnerable to attackers when they are not within striking range.
